Transaction 59dd4ff5dadd093616825c87926f58238e65962cf34eeae010bfa6bcc4010a44
1 Input
1 Output
-
59dd4ff5dadd093616825c87926f58238e65962cf34eeae010bfa6bcc4010a44:0
- value
- 2539791
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37aca6fb249c18c48c34c03dbeeefc0359377733 OP_EQUALVERIFY OP_CHECKSIG
- address
- 165NzeAE1rKpUjm5izmmQ6nank1yrUWq9r